Meaning of dun
- A mound or small hill.
- To cure, as codfish, in a particular manner, by laying them, after salting, in a pile in a dark place, covered with salt grass or some like substance.
- To ask or beset, as a debtor, for payment; to urge importunately.
- One who duns; a dunner.
- An urgent request or demand of payment; as, he sent his debtor a dun.
- Of a dark color; of a color partaking of a brown and black; of a dull brown color; swarthy.
